Performance Characteristics of 35KV Grade Oil-immersed Transformer S11-630~31500/35:

1, The oil-immersed transformer low-voltage winding in addition to small capacity using copper wire, generally use copper foil around the shaft of the cylinder structure, high-voltage winding using multi-layer cylinder structure, so that the winding of the safety balance, small leakage, high mechanical strength, strong ability to resist short circuit.
2, Iron heart and winding each adopted fastening measures, machine height, low-pressure lead and other fastening parts are self-locking anti-loose nuts, the use of non-hanging structure, can withstand the shock of transport.
3, Coil and iron core using vacuum drying, transformer oil using vacuum filter oil and oil injection process, so that the transformer internal moisture to minimize.
4, The tank using corrugated, it has a breathing function to compensate for the change in the volume of oil caused by temperature changes, so the product does not have a storage tank, obviously reduce the height of the transformer.
5, Because the corrugated plate replaced the oil storage cabinet, so that transformer oil isolated from the outside world, which effectively preventtheentry of oxygen, water and lead to a decline in insulation performance.
6, According to the above five points of performance, to ensure that the oil-immersed transformer in the normal operation does not need to change oil, greatly reducing the maintenance costs of the transformer, while extending the life of the oil-immersed transformer.
